Компьютерный форум OSzone.net  

Компьютерный форум OSzone.net (http://forum.oszone.net/index.php)
-   Хочу все знать (http://forum.oszone.net/forumdisplay.php?f=23)
-   -   Архив InstallShield (http://forum.oszone.net/showthread.php?t=58390)

Surround 21-12-2005 15:41 385440

Архив InstallShield
 
Есть установочный файл, запакованный InstallShield. Можно ли как-нить его "распотрошить", и достать содержимое, не запуская установки?

Blast 21-12-2005 17:33 385492

Surround
А простым WinRar`ом не пробовал? У меня вот получилось без проблем (пробовал на атишных дровах)

Surround 21-12-2005 17:41 385500

Blast
не, не получается. не открывет как архив...

Blast 21-12-2005 17:44 385502

Попробуй вот плагин к Far manager`у:
Цитата:

Плагин позволяет входить в exe файлы созданные инсталляторами: Wise, Vise, Inno Setup, Gentee Installer, InstallShield, NullSoft Installer (ver>=1.1o), SetupFactory, Eschalon. И msi файлы созданные Windows Installer.
Забрать можно отсюда:
http://plugring.farmanager.com/downl...texpl_v0.3.rar

а вдруг...


Blast 21-12-2005 17:55 385515

Ну и вот набор WinPack, тоже вроде умеет
Цитата:

This program acts as GUI shell for command line’s unpackers, used for InstallShield v3.0, v5.X, v5.5 & v6.X archives
http://snoopy81.ifrance.com/snoopy81/en/winpack.htm


Surround 21-12-2005 18:25 385526

Blast
WinPack не помог - пишет что неопределить тип архива...

нашел в свойствах: This installation was built with Inno Setup
а как к Far этот плагин приаттачить? просто положить в Plugins?

ShaRP 21-12-2005 19:15 385544

Surround
Вот сюда советую заглянуть. С помощью чего-то из выложенного там я и решил в свое время подобную задачу. Чего конкретно - к сожалению, не помню. На сайте должны быть и статьи по данной тематике.

Blast 21-12-2005 19:16 385545

Surround
Не знаю даже...
Ну хорошо, распаковать не получается, но ведь он (инсталлер) при запуске куда-то распаковывает содержимое, и скорее всего в системный темп, то есть можно его запустить, дождаться когда он распакует файлы и не нажимая next посмотреть в темпе.

С плагином я сам не разобрался, то есть он установился, и в настройках типа энейбл, а что дальше делать... загадка :)
Написал автору сего чуда, пусть расшифрует...

XPEHOMETP 23-12-2005 10:13 386069

Если это инсталляция, сделанная с Inno Setup, то сия инсталляха бесплатная, для прописывания зловредных ключиков в реестр вроде не предназначена. Во всяком случае, авторы шароварных программ обычно не прописывают триальные ключики при установке с Inno Setup (очевидно, они легко отслеживаются по конфигурационным файлам или логу установки), а занимается этим сама прога при первом ее запуске. Я считаю, что установка программы без ее запуска вполне безопасна, в реестр при этом будет занесена только информация, необходимая для деинсталляции программы. Если, конечно, это действительно Inno Setup.

Surround 24-12-2005 00:12 386332

XPEHOMETP
дело в том, что этим инсталлятором был запакован патч, криво проверяющий установку программы, а без нахождения оной полностью отказывался его ставить, а файлы из него были очень нужны.
проблему решил, по ссылочке ShaRP с помощью программки Inno Setup Unpacker
Спасибо за помощь!


Время: 01:06.

Время: 01:06.
© OSzone.net 2001-